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Oracle12cweb 170627162704 PDF
Oracle12cweb 170627162704 PDF
INDICE
1. Descarga de herramientas.
1.1. Oracle Linux 7.
1.2. Motor base de datos.
1.3. Forms and reports.
1.4. Fmw Middleware
1.5. Rufus.
1.6. Java JDK.
1.7. Adobe Flash Player.
1.8. Ápex.
1.9.Jacob.
2. Instalación Oracle Linux 7
2.1. Crear USB boteable.
2.2. Instalación.
2.3. Agregando discos duros.
2.4. Instalando Adobe Flash Player.
2.5. Instalación JDK.
3. Instalando VNC.
3.1.Conectándose al vnc.
4. Preparando el entorno.
5. Instalación motor base de datos.
6. Configurar Listener.
6.1.Arrancar y parar Listener.
7. Creación de Base de datos.
8. Instalando Ápex.
9. Exportar base de datos.
10. Importar base de datos.
11. Instalando Forms and Reports.
11.1. Instalando el Middleware.
11.2. Instalando Motif.
11.3. Instalación Forms And Reports.
11.4.Creación de Schema.
11.5.Creación de Dominio.
11.6.Arrancando Servicios.
12. Configuración Forms And Reports.
12.1.Configurando Forms.
12.2.Compilando Formas.
12.3.Configurando webutil.
12.4.Accediendo al sistema.
12.5.Compilando todas las formas.
12.6.Configurando Reports.
13. Monitoreo de reportes.
13.1.Ingresar al server reports.
13.2.Ver trabajos.
13.3.Ver información servidor.
Colaboradores:
Jorge Alberto Ríos.
INICIO
1. Descarga de herramientas:
1.5. Rufus:
url: https://rufus.akeo.ie/?locale=es_ES
1.8. Ápex:
url: http://www.oracle.com/technetwork/developer-
tools/apex/downloads/index.html
INICIO
INICIO
• Le damos en aceptar:
INICIO
2.2. Instalación:
INICIO
INICIO
INICIO
• Clic en signo + para crear la partición de boot que debe ser mínimo
por 250M yo la creare por 600M. y añadir punto de montaje.
• Y por último damos clic en + para crear la partición del home del
sistema operativo que sea por el espacio restante de nuestro disco
duro, en mi caso será de 834G. y añadir punto de montaje.
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
Nota: Si solo vamos a usar un disco duro pasar al tema 2.4 clic aquí. En
este ejemplo agregaremos 3 discos duros adicionales de 1T cada uno.
INICIO
INICIO
INICIO
INICIO
INICIO
• Guardamos y listo.
INICIO
• Empieza la instalación:
INICIO
3. Instalando VNC.
INICIO
• Le damos Y enter.
VNC Softgen:
VNC Oracle:
INICIO
• Guardamos.
• Ahora abrimos una consola con el usuario softgen para generar la
contraseña de conexión de softgen por vnc. Y escribimos el
comando vncpasswd
INICIO
INICIO
• Por ultimo debemos parar el firewall o crear una regla para abrir el
puerto 5901 en mi caso detendré el firewall debemos ser usuario
root, con el siguiente comando:
Ahora procederemos a conectarnos vía vnc con el usuario softgen para ello
abrimos nuestro cliente vnc en mi caso es vnc viewer y creamos una nueva
conexión.
• Nos pide la Ip del servidor más el puerto que para softgen es 5901 y
para oracle 5903 y el nombre que le queramos dar a la conexión:
INICIO
INICIO
INICIO
4. Preparando el entorno:
INICIO
INICIO
Nota: Recordemos que trabajamos en el disco que está montado en bd, por
eso se crearon las carpetas en /bd, si fuera desde la raíz la ruta seria:
/u01/app/Oracle
INICIO
INICIO
• Ahora nos podemos conectar por medio del cliente vnc (seguir estos
pasos aquí).
INICIO
INICIO
• Y corremos el runInstaller .
INICIO
INICIO
INICIO
• En esta pantalla que nos muestra los grupos dejamos todo por
defecto tal cual y damos en siguiente.
• Empieza la instalación.
INICIO
INICIO
INICIO
6. Configurando Listener:
INICIO
INICIO
INICIO
INICIO
INICIO
• Y ejecutamos el dbca.
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
8. Instalación Ápex:
INICIO
INICIO
INICIO
INICIO
.
• Ahora configuramos el listener del ápex con el siguiente script
apex_rest_config.sql
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
• Nos aparecerán cientos de líneas, pero nos interesa las que no tiene
el mensaje de permiso denegado, y que empiece por /usr/java y que
este dentro del directorio /jre acá la subraye:
INICIO
• Ahora debemos ejecutar este .jar con el ejecutable java para ello
debemos poner la ruta de donde está el ejecutable java, el comando
–jar y el archivo.jar así :
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
• Nos aparecerá los tablespace que se crearan los dejamos tal cual y
le damos clic en siguiente.
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
• Nos muestra los puertos por donde correrán el forms y el reports los
dejamos por defecto y siguiente.
INICIO
INICIO
• Acá nos permite asignar algún servidor a los clúster pero como no
tenemos aún ninguno lo dejamos por defecto y siguiente.
INICIO
INICIO
INICIO
• Como no usaremos ningún destino virtual dejamos tal cual como nos
aparece y siguiente.
INICIO
• Acá nos aparece los componentes que tendremos, solo nos aparece
el del forms, tocara agregar el OHS1 por tal motivo damos clic en
agregar.
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
INICIO
• Nos aparecerá los servicios que están ejecutándose y los que están
shutdown.
INICIO
INICIO
INICIO
INICIO
INICIO
• Ahora falta correr el servicio de OHS para ello abrimos una nueva
pestaña y ponemos la siguiente url: http://localhost:7001/em
INICIO
INICIO
INICIO
INICIO
• Y listo ya con esto nos carga la forma de ejemplo el cual dice que la
instalación ha sido exitosa.
INICIO
Ahora vamos a configurar nuestro dominio del forms and reports, para ello
empezaremos con las formas, en el presente manual vamos a suponer que ya
tenemos una forma creada, la cual debemos ponerla en un directorio donde el
forms la vea y ejecute.
INICIO
INICIO
INICIO
• Clic en close.
INICIO
INICIO
/software/Oracle/Middleware/Oracle_Home/user_projects/
domains/smbd/config/fmwconfig/components/FORMS/inst
ances/forms1/admin/resources/US/frmpcweb.res
INICIO
INICIO
#configuracion adiccional
baseHTMLJInitiator=basejpi.htm
WebUtilArchive=jacob.jar,frmwebutil.jar
WebUtilLogging=off
WebUtilLoggingDetail=normal
WebUtilErrorMode=Alert
WebUtilDispatchMonitorInterval=5
WebUtilTrustInternal=true
WebUtilMaxTransferSize=16384
baseHTMLjpi=webutiljpi.htm
jpi_codebase=http://java.sun.com/update/1.7.0/jinstall-7u21-
windows-i586.cab#Version=1,7,0,2
• Quedándonos así:
INICIO
• Y listo guardamos.
INICIO
• Y guardamos.
INICIO
• Y listo.
Para poder que nuestro forms nos ejecute las formas, estas deberán
estar compiladas, por lo tanto deberemos cargar las formas a
nuestro directorio /software/formas, de allí al ejecutar el compilador
nos copiara las formas compiladas al directorio /software/forms/bin
INICIO
INICIO
• Y guardamos.
#!/bin/sh
#export NLS_LANG=SPANISH_SPAIN.WE8MSWIN1252
export TNS_ADMIN=/bd/u01/app/oracle/product/12.2.0/db_1/network/admin
export
RUNNABLE=/software/Oracle/Middleware/Oracle_Home/user_projects/domains/s
mbcd d/config/fmwconfig/components/FORMS/instances/forms1
echo "compiling form $1 " >> forms.lst
$RUNNABLE/bin/frmcmp.sh module=$1 module_type=FORM
userid=C##PZN/contraseña@orcl compile_all=YES
cp *.*x ../bin
echo "Copying form: $1 to ../bin"
echo "Finished"
pwd
exit 0
INICIO
• Guardamos el archivo.
• Las formas están en formato fmb, al compilarlas nos creara un
nuevo archivo con formato fmx en el directorio /software/forms/bin,
para ellos corremos el script acabado de crear:
• A veces después del enter toca darle control c para que compile
cuando termina deberá aparecernos esto
INICIO
INICIO
INICIO
• Guardamos.
INICIO
INICIO
/forms/bin
/software/Oracle/Middleware/Oracle_Home/forms
/software/Oracle/Middleware/Oracle_Home/forms/java/frmall.jar
/software/Oracle/Middleware/Oracle_Home/forms/java/Jacob.jar
/software/Oracle/Middleware/Oracle_Home/forms/java/frmmain.jar
/software/Oracle/Middleware/Oracle_Home/forms/java/frmresources.jar
/software/Oracle/Middleware/Oracle_Home/forms/java/frmsal.jar
• Y guardamos el archivo.
INICIO
INICIO
INICIO
createReportsToolsInstance(instanceName=’RepTools1’,machine=’
AdminServerMachine’)
createReportsServerInstance(instanceName=’MyServer1’,machine=’
AdminServerMachine’)
INICIO
• Y guardamos.
INICIO
INICIO
• Y guardamos.
• Ahora ingresamos a la ruta
/software/Oracle/Middleware/Oracle_Home/user_projects/domains/s
mbd/config/fmwconfig/servers/WLS_REPORTS/applications/reports_
12.2.1/configuration
INICIO
• Y guardamos.
INICIO
• Ingresamos a la url:
http://ipservidor:9002/reports/rwservlet/showjobs?
INICIO
INICIO
INICIO